  1. cold-blooded

    • IPA[ˌkəʊldˈblʌdɪd]

    英式

    • adj.
      denoting animals whose body temperature varies with that of the environment (e.g. fish); poikilothermic.;without emotion or pity; deliberately cruel or callous
    • 釋義

    形容詞

    • 1. denoting animals whose body temperature varies with that of the environment (e.g. fish); poikilothermic.
    • 2. without emotion or pity; deliberately cruel or callous a cold-blooded murder
